Creates new External Document Record in Legito.
Creates new Document Record with Document Version.
Creates a new label.
Creates new Push Connection from the Legito.
Creates new External Link for selected Document Records with given privileges.
Creates a new Object Record for a given Object type by its ID.
Creates new User with default permissions.
Deletes a document record.
Deletes existing file attached to specified Document Record.

A scenario represents a workflow or a project of your own creation, and it is made up of a series of modules that automate apps and services. Creating a scenario allows you to transfer and transform data between apps and services via these modules to automate anything and improve the way you work.
Modules are the main building blocks of automation in Make. Modules represent actions that Make performs with an app, like creating, updating, or deleting data.
Mapping links the modules in your scenario. When you map an item, you connect the data retrieved by one module to another module to perform the desired action. For example, you can map email addresses and subject lines to create a spreadsheet using this data.
